kernel: Add zfs kmod build to the kernel build
This adds building the zfs-kmod package to the kernel build. The zfs-kmod packages contains the matching ZFS kernel modules for a given kernel in /lib/modules/$(uname -r)/extra. The zfs-kmod package also contains the standard kernel modules and depmod is run over them so that modprobe works The zfs-kmod package is not build by default due to unclarity about licenses.
